Basic stats in soldier list
Any way or mods for EW that allows the basic stats (aim, will, move, etc.) to be shown on the soldier list? it makes the squad selection much easier, and who i can turn into a MEC

Can't help with mods, but I can offer advice to make the other bits easier to understand.

https://xcom.fandom.com/wiki/Stat_Growth_(XCOM:_Enemy_Unknown)
Unless you're using the second wave options Not Created Equally and/or Hidden Potential the move stat is the same across all classes.

Also with either of those second wave options who's best at aim will be, from best to worst: Snipers, Supports, Assaults, Heavies.

Will is the only really random one and it will go up with the same chance no matter who you turn into a MEC. If you're trying to max out your MEC's stats then beyond what class they are that's the only one you need to make note of when scrolling though your troops.

If you want your MEC to have the best aim, then convert a max rank sniper. The same is largely true of the support and the Assault.
I hear that Heavies are best converted anytime before Captain, which works fine more me as the first MEC I make in any campaign will ALWAYS be a heavy as it gives them best ability in the early game to long enough to keep being useful.
